Company overview

The Doctors Company is a leading provider of medical malpractice insurance, offering comprehensive coverage and risk management services to healthcare professionals. Founded in 1976, it has grown to become the largest physician-owned medical malpractice insurer in the United States. The company generates revenue through insurance premiums and invests in risk management programs to help reduce claims. Notably, The Doctors Company is committed to advancing, protecting, and rewarding the practice of good medicine, reflecting its deep-rooted history in supporting healthcare providers.
